Description

What is this?
A proximity sensor is a type of sensor that detects the presence or absence of objects without physical contact. It can detect the proximity of an object within its sensing range and trigger a response or action based on the detected proximity.

What will I get?
Product Type: Inductive Proximity Sensor Switch
Model: LJ12A3-4-Z/BX
Output Type: NO Normally Open NPN
Thread Specification: M12
Detection Distance: 4mm/0.16 Inch
Cable Length: 1.2m/3.94 Feet
Rated Operating Voltage: DC 6-36V
Output Current: 200mA
In the package of: 2pcs Proximity Sensor + 2Pcs brackets

Are there any advantages of the product?
Non-contact Detection: Proximity sensors can detect the presence or absence of objects without physical contact, which helps prevent wear and tear.
Fast Response Time: Proximity sensors provide quick and accurate detection, durability and reliability, enhancing efficiency in automation processes.
Wide Applications: Proximity sensors are used in diverse industries including automotive, manufacturing, robotics, and consumer electronics for tasks like object detection, motion sensing, and level sensing.
